Ku波段介质锁相抗振频率源研制

Development of Ku-band Phase-locked Dielectric Resonator Frequency Source with Anti-vibration Performance

【摘要】 提出了一种混频介质锁相的方案,对Ku波段的发射信号进行一次混频锁相得到Ku波段的本振信号,实现了本振信号与发射信号的相位同步。电路设计采用了低噪底鉴相芯片和自主设计的低相噪Ku波段介质压控振荡器(DRVCO)。结构设计中充分考虑抗振动性能,并用ANSYS软件对结构进行力学仿真,达到很好的抗振动效果,组件外形尺寸为110mm×65mm×13mm。测试结果表明,静态下该Ku波段频率源输出功率12dBm,杂波抑制比≥70dBc,相位噪声-91dBc/Hz/@1kHz,-105dBc/Hz@10kHz;振动条件下1kHz、10kHz处相位噪声恶化不超过3dB。

【Abstract】 This paper presents a method of mixing dielectric resonator phase-locked loop,performs a mixing phase lock to obtain the local oscillation(LC)signal of Ku-band,realizes the phase synchronization between the LC signal and transmitting signal.The circuit design adopts a low noise floor phase discrimination chip and independent designed low phase noise Ku-band dielectric resonator voltage-control oscillator.Anti-vibration performance is fully considered in the structure design and structural mechanics simulation is performed by using ANSYS software,which brings well anti-vibration performance.The outline dimension is 110 mm ×65mm ×13mm.To the Kuband frequency source,the test results show that the output power is 12 dBm,the clutter rejection ratio is more than 70 dBc,the phase noises are- 91dBc/Hz@ 1kHz,- 105dBc/Hz@ 10 kHz in static state;the phase noises worsen no more than 3dB at 1kHz and 10 kHz in vibrant state.
